ESR India's Abhijit Malkani discusses how sustainability, technology, and marketspecific strategies are shaping the evolution of industrial real estate.

DRIVING THE FUTURE OF WAREHOUSING AND INDUSTRIAL REAL ESTATE

The Industrial and warehousing real estate space in India is undergoing a lot of transformation. With the sector's rapid growth fueled by the e-commerce boom and the global recalibration of supply chains, it stands as a beacon of resilience and innovation. At the helm of this transformation is Abhijit Malkani, CEO of ESR India, who brings a wealth of knowledge and a visionary approach to one of the country's most dynamic industries.

For Malkani, the journey of ESR India is rooted in a commitment to innovation, sustainability, and collaboration. As he aptly notes, the industrial and warehousing real estate market is no longer confined to traditional brick-and-mortar facilities.

"It's about creating ecosystems that cater to evolving customer needs, optimise operations, and align with environmental goals," he shares.

PIONEERING MARKET-SPECIFIC STRATEGIES

One of the hallmarks of ESR India's approach under Malkani's leadership is its market-specific strategy.

India's vast and diverse geography, coupled with varied consumer demands, necessitates tailored solutions.

ESR India has embraced this complexity, focusing on regional requirements to create bespoke warehousing and logistics facilities.

"Each market in India Malkani has unique challenges and opportunities," explains. "Understanding the local nuances helps us deliver value to our clients while ensuring operational efficiency." From robust infrastructure established urban hubs to tapping potential in TierII and Tier-III cities, ESR's approach highlights agility and adaptability.
